CANoe车载测试常见问题深度解析(上)
版权申诉
168 浏览量
更新于2024-06-16
收藏 1.56MB DOCX 举报
车载测试Vector工具CANoe——常见问题汇总(上)
本文档针对汽车电子工程师在使用Vector公司的CANoe这款强大的车载总线开发环境中遇到的常见问题进行了详细的探讨。CANoe作为一款专为汽车总线开发设计的工具,支持CANopen环境,涵盖了从需求分析到系统实现的全过程,适用于网络设计、开发和测试工程师。
1. **背景信息**:
CANoe是Vector的核心产品,它不仅是CAN(Controller Area Network)协议的模拟器,还是一个集成的平台,可以用于构建、配置和测试复杂的汽车网络系统。它不仅用于ECU(Electronic Control Unit)的功能评估和测试,还在系统集成和故障诊断中发挥重要作用。
2. **配置需求分析**:
使用CANoe时,开发者需确保正确配置项目参数,这包括所需的数据速率、帧格式、节点ID等,以匹配实际的硬件和应用需求。同时,了解CANalyzer中的数据库设置对于解析报文至关重要,特别是添加了数据库后,能帮助识别报文内容。
3. **处理大数据**:
当遇到超过4095字节的数据传输,可通过特殊的处理方式,如拆分或使用非标准帧格式(如CAN FD, Flexible Data Rate)来实现。CANoe支持这些高级功能,但需遵循相应的规范和适配策略。
4. **NACK测试**:
NAK(Not Acknowledged)测试是验证通信是否正常的关键步骤。在CANoe中,可以通过配置适当的测试脚本来模拟发送带有NACK的报文,并检查目标ECU的响应,以确保可靠的数据交换。
5. **性能瓶颈**:
在使用过程中,如果发现Trace窗口显示LinkDown或CPU负载过高,可能是因为成对出现的EthernetPackets造成。优化网络配置,降低冗余数据传输,有助于提高系统的稳定性和效率。
6. **CANFD信号创建**:
CANoe支持CAN Flexible Data Rate(CAN FD),允许创建超过8字节长度的信号,这对于高性能或复杂数据传输非常有用。开发者需要熟悉CANoe的高级功能和相关配置步骤,以实现高效的数据通信。
总结来说,本文档深入剖析了CANoe在车载测试中的实用技巧和注意事项,包括配置、数据处理、故障诊断和性能优化等方面,旨在帮助工程师们更好地利用CANoe进行高效、准确的汽车总线测试和开发工作。通过解决这些问题,用户可以提升工作效率并确保产品的质量。
1002 浏览量
229 浏览量
222 浏览量
114 浏览量
114 浏览量
238 浏览量
车载诊断技术
- 粉丝: 7712
- 资源: 793
最新资源
- roam-themez:漫游研究CSS主题
- IPO-Market-Forecasting
- flutter_smart_course:内置的智能课程应用程序
- Co1_out_Courseoutline_
- hbase-1.2.6
- 易语言-最新版PC微信2.8.0.121 hook源码分享
- 99taxis-recruitment
- MyTerm:平面UI RS232串行端口通信实用程序,可以以十六进制或ASCII格式显示接收到的数据,从而允许您配置连接参数
- 证书生成器:Python opencv程序,单击即可生成批量证书
- Data-Science-Experiments
- kodexplorer3.2无限制版
- Image Resizer-crx插件
- json2html-bookmarks:将Firefox书签从JSON转换为HTML格式(可以在其他浏览器中导入)
- 10kb-webserver-error-Pages
- wweir.github.io:温习江湖的个人博客
- 毕业设计-BOOT客户管理系统源码(免费、无需积分)